Beef and poultry price hike as consequence of ASF virus

As of May 21st, poultry producers were allowed to raise selling prices by 10% to overcome the disparity in prices on the domestic and foreign markets. Due to the ban on pork imports from several EU countries and the impossibility to organise meat supply from Canada and Brazil in the short term, the pork deficit will continue and the demand for poultry and beef will increase. Meat exports might be restricted, meat prices will continue growing until supplies from third countries have returned to normal or restrictions on meat imports from the EU have been lifted. Also, control over meat prices will be strengthened inside Belarus and the financial health of meat producers will somewhat improve.
